Daily British Whig (Kingston, ON), 9 Apr 1864
- Full Text
p.3 K.C. & M. - the steamer Ottawa "was on the Railway all winter, having her hull repaired, engine reversed, and having her two smokestacks taken down and replaced by one large one..."
-navigation open between Dunkirk and Cleveland, Sandusky, Toledo, Detroit and the upper lake ports.
-Grand Trunk Line of Steamers - the B.F. Wade, Antelope, Sun, Montgomery, Kenosha, S.D. Caldwell, Governor Cushman, and Ontonagon are to run from Port Sarnia to Chicago.
